Investing in Transformation

If the Gospel is truly a global venture that is worth our lives both individually and together, then we will naturally be investing ourselves in transformation.  As we taste personal transformation through intimacy with God and involvement with others, we will naturally be seeking to invest in the transformation of the world; sharing the Gospel in words and showing the Gospel through deeds that open up possibilities for Gospel-conversations.

We will invest in transformation through engaging the culture/s in which we live with the Gospel in the language of that culture.   Seeing all of life as being on mission with God, we  see investment in transformation as holistic, utilizing our gifts, time, talent, and experiences as avenues to bring transformation into the world.  Realizing that we can not take on a task this large alone, we gladly enter into partnerships with other churches and para-church ministries to accomplish more with others than we can apart in community, city, and global ministry ventures.

This idea of investment in transformation has as its essence the desire to be Christ-like and display Him, in highlighting the gospel through tangible acts of kindness and service to people that highlights the gospel to the world.

Missional Living:  We value seeing all of our life as being on mission with God, i.e. showing and sharing the Gospel.  In essence, we don’t just “go on mission trips” as much as the whole of our lives being a mission trip, with all of us being missionaries.  Since we are God’s unique work, we value working out what God has worked in us with the totality of our lives.  God has placed us in this time, in this city for His purposes and under His direction.  (Matthew 28:18-20, Ephesians 2:8-10)

Serving People:  Since we desire to be Christ-like and display Him, we seek to be His hands and feet to people all over our world.  If Christ loves people we must love people.  We don’t wish to make the world just a nicer place before people go to hell, but we wish to display God’s generosity in the gospel through tangible acts of kindness and service to people that highlights the gospel to the world.  (Matthew 20:28-9, Titus 2:10)

Kingdom Partnerships:  We value partnering with other churches  and parachurch ministries for the sake of the Gospel in community, city, and global ministry ventures.    Partnering allows us to leverage resources, ideas, and prayer for the mutual strengthening of one another as we seek to advance the cause of Christ.

Cultural Engagement:  We define culture as “a place in which we live that shapes how we think and live.”  We value saturating our area with the Gospel in a language that is understandable to our various cultures.  We seek to engage and change our culture through the contextualization and content of the Gospel.  (1 Corinthians 9, Acts 17)
